Default Washer hose - how is it routed?

Hey gentlemen, I had this post up before with little help. I installed a new washer pump but now find the rear hose (the front is working fine) is leaking from somewhere in the back of the right front tire kinda in the fender well. My question is does anybody know the routing of the rear washer line? Can I access it from removing the inner fender well?

My 2003 model has the hose traveling from rear right side up middle spine to below gear lever, then under right drivers seat and from there not too sure. Hose is in a channel of the floor with the electrical wires but channel stops under the seat.

The channel I mention is under the carpet. Try lifting carpet, inside rear door, on right side, near pillar. Check for rubber hose there. You may have plastic hose though and 2003 differs from 2006 but lets see for future reference.
